KDHE Kicks Off 'Get Caught Recycling' Campaign
News Conference, Mon. Nov. 21, 10 a.m.,
Curtis Building, 5th Floor, 1000 SW Jackson, Topeka
During a news conference on Monday, Nov. 21 at 10 a.m. in Topeka, the Kansas Department of
Health and Environment (KDHE) will announce the launch of an exciting new campaign, to be seen
statewide in the coming weeks, called 'Get Caught Recycling.'
The public awareness campaign features prominent Kansans 'caught' in the act of recycling
including a veteran broadcaster, a former governor, and two former college basketball stars. Local
heroes from several communities across the state will also be featured in the campaign.
Some of the Kansans featured in the PSAs will also be attending the news conference where
the details of the campaign will be announced.
The news conference will be at KDHE in the Curtis Building (5th floor) at 1000 SW Jackson,
in Topeka.
